He worked in the Committee on Employment and Work (2002–2005) and in the Committee on Youth and Sports (2005–2006).
He served as Vice-President of the National Gypsy/Roma Council (OCÖ/ORÖ) since 1999. Lukács died on 18 October 2012, at the age of 57, following a long illness.
